No legitimate, legal lottery notifies winners vian email (see footnote) The scammers may change the names and details, but it is still a scam! Below is the example of the fake email scam (the email is the scam, not any persons or companies named in the email) claiming to be from the "AUSTRALIA LOTTO LOTTERY INC.". It is a scam.
